Election Results
General elections
Election date | Party leader | Number of votes received | Percentage of votes | Number of deputies |
---|---|---|---|---|
November 3, 2002 | Recep Tayyip Erdoğan | 10,763,904 | 34.26% | 363 |
July 22, 2007 | Recep Tayyip Erdoğan | 16,327,291 | 46.58% | 341 |
June 12, 2011 | Recep Tayyip Erdoğan | 21,442,206 | 49.83% | 326 |
Local elections
Election date | Party leader | Provincial council votes | Percentage of votes | Number of municipalities |
---|---|---|---|---|
March 28, 2004 | Recep Tayyip Erdoğan | 13,447,287 | 42.18% | 1750 |
March 29, 2009 | Recep Tayyip Erdoğan | 15,513,554 | 38.83% | 1404 |
Referendums
Election date | Party leader | Yes vote | Percentage | No vote | Percentage | AK Party's support |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
October 21, 2007 | Recep Tayyip Erdoğan | 19,422,714 | 68.95 | 8,744,947 | 31.05 | Yes vote |
September 12, 2010 | Recep Tayyip Erdoğan | 21,787,244 | 57.88 | 15,856,79 | 42.12 | Yes vote |
